Naksosa is a Rural village located in Amarpur, Banka, Bihar.
The total population of Naksosa is 987.
Naksosa village comprises 216 households.
The literacy rate in Naksosa is 69.2%. Among the literate population of 563, there are 333 literate males and 230 literate females.
In Naksosa, there are 522 males and 465 females, with a sex ratio of 891 females per 1000 males.
There are 173 children (17.5% of population), comprising 90 boys and 83 girls.
The total number of workers in Naksosa is 329, with 284 main workers and 45 marginal workers.
In Naksosa, there are 5 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(3 males, 2 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Naksosa is located in Bihar state, Banka district, and falls under Amarp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 240700 and LGD code is 240700.
